The technical design document provides a blueprint for the software engineers in your team to implement and code the features of your game. It is a specification, or design blueprint, for a software program or feature. The technical design document will let your developers to specify what are the requirements, how they should be implemented, along with the tools and technologies required for the implementation. The first example of technical writing in english dates back to the middle ages when chaucer wrote a guide to the astrolabea device used for measuring the distance of stars. A design doc also known as a technical spec is a description of how you plan to solve a problem. There are lots of writings already on why its important to write a design doc before diving into coding. While your project may require a custom design document structure, you might want to consider including some of the following commonly used sections. The content and organization of an sdd is specified by the ieee 1016 standard. Example of software design document sdd sample sdd 1 creator. A design doc is the most useful tool for making sure the right work gets done. Here are the main recommendations points to include in your product requirement document.
These documents include memos, fliers, graphics, brochures, handbooks, web pages, instructions, specifications, catalogs and today the technical documentation is progressively being delivered online. So naturally, since every problem is different, there can be no onefitsall template. Technical design document and game design document. This software technical specification template is a word document with traditional outline formatting. Writing technical design docs machine words medium. A technical design doc describes a solution to a given technical problem. How to make and write a tdd technical design document part 1. Create a comprehensive document describing project scope, user information, product features, assumptions and dependencies, system features, interface requirements, and other specifications.
How to make and write a tdd technical design document part 1 letscreateagame. The software design document sdd typically describes a software products data design, architecture design, interface design, and procedural design. One webpage software requirements document created by using atlassian confluence, the content collaboration software. How to write a technical specification or software design.
1339 1518 1108 311 1213 97 833 1161 1396 198 867 221 165 970 1291 113 422 906 118 54 637 35 648 1330 1041 1524 1014 1035 944 1049 46 1280 679 1172 913 1441 1498 970